In the First Cycle the Stockholm University Department of Human Geography offers programmes and separate courses. The language of instruction in all programmes and most of the courses is Swedish. Education clearly reflects the research and active researchers teach at all levels. In the First Cycle students will meet both very experienced teachers and young academics.

The Department is relatively small – which provides good conditions for excellent relations between students and between students, teachers and other staff. On the other hand the Department is large enough to offer courses and tuition in a wide spectrum. The Department offers a good and stimulating learning environment. Field courses and excursions are priority elements in teaching. Paper and thesis writing is a central part in education.

Human Geography

To obtain a Bachelor degree in Human Geography there are four ways: 1. The Bachelor's Programme in Human Geography – Society, Environment and Global Processes, 180 HECs. 2. Two semesters of Human Geography in addition to the obligatory courses at the Bachelor's Programme in Urban and Regional Planning, 180 HECs. 3. Human Geography as the main field of studies within the Cultural Studies Programme, 180 HECs. 4. Study Human Geography as separate courses (including three semesters in Human Geography, totally 90 HECs) and combine with other courses. Some courses in Human Geography may also be included in the Bachelor's Programme in Geography, 180 HECs, and Bachelor's Programme in Urban and Regional Planning, 180 HECs, and several other study programmes.

Urban and Regional Planning

For a Bachelor degree in Urban and Regional Planning the student have to be accepted to the Bachelor's Programme in Urban and Regional Planning, 180 HECs. Depending on the choice of courses it is possible to also receive a Bachelor degree in Human Geography, Economics or Statistics after completing the three years.

Geography

For a Bachelor degree in Geography the student can either study separate courses or the Bachelor's Programme in Geography, 180 HECs. The Study Programme for Master of Education and Master of Science, Specialization in Geography, 330 HECs, consists of courses from the First Cycle and the Second Cycle. There is also a Teacher Education Programme with specialization in Geography for school year 7-9 and the upper secondary school, 270 HECs.
